IMD Recruitment 2025: Unlocking Opportunities
The IMD is seeking talented individuals to fill the following roles:
- Project Scientist E (1 position): With a salary of Rs. 123,100 + HRA, this role demands a Master's degree or B.Tech, along with a Doctorate or M.Tech, and 11 years of experience.
- Project Scientist III (13 positions): Offering Rs. 78,000 + HRA, this role requires a similar educational background and 7 years of experience.
- Project Scientist II (29 positions): A salary of Rs. 67,000 + HRA is on the table for this role, which also requires a Master's or B.Tech, and 3 years of experience.
- Project Scientist I (64 positions): This role, with a salary of Rs. 56,000 + HRA, is open to candidates with a Master's or B.Tech, and a Doctorate or M.Tech is preferred.
- Scientific Assistant (25 positions): A Bachelor's degree in Science, Computer Science, IT, Electronics, or Telecom is required for this role, with a salary of Rs. 29,200 + HRA.
- Admin Assistant (1 position): A Bachelor's degree, along with computer skills, is essential for this role, which also offers a salary of Rs. 29,200 + HRA.
Eligibility and Application Process
To apply for these roles, you must meet the following criteria:
- Indian nationality is a must.
- The essential qualifications and experience vary per post, so be sure to check the official notification for details.
- The maximum age limit also varies, ranging from 30 to 50 years, depending on the position.
- Age and experience relaxation is provided for reserved categories, as per Government rules.
- All eligibility criteria must be met by the closing date of applications.
The application process is straightforward:
- Visit the IMD Recruitment Portal (https://mausam.imd.gov.in/) and apply online.
- You must apply separately for each eligible post you wish to be considered for.
- Ensure you upload all relevant, self-attested documents.
- Double-check all details before submitting your application.
- The last date to apply is 14th December 2025.
Selection Process
The selection process is designed to identify the most suitable candidates:
- Screening will be based on eligibility and qualifications.
- Shortlisted candidates will be invited for an interview.
- The final selection will be based on interview performance.
- No TA/DA will be provided for the interview.
